The village of Bozhurovo, in Razgrad district, Northeastern Bulgaria, is known as one of the villages with the largest number of stork nests - 24 in total.
The residents believe that the village is chosen by the migratory birds because of the clean air and the nearby ponds and fertile agricultural areas that provide plenty of food. At the moment, the baby storks are in the nests, some of them can already be seen making their first attempts at flying.
